### Clock skew on build agents

If Marlin builds fail with "artifact from the future," it's agent clock skew again. Check drift on the pool via the Timekeep status endpoint before blaming the cache. Anything over 2s gets the agent drained and resynced. The status endpoint wants the internal key below.

service key, fawip-bajef: kto11_Qt5wZK9vdNC

Onboarding — GraphQL N+1 fix (Orderloom API)

Context: the `ordersByCustomer` resolver used to fire one query per line item. We fixed it with a batched dataloader in `loaders/lineitems`. Do not add per-field resolvers that hit the Tallow DB directly; route everything through the loader. Query counts are asserted in CI, so regressions fail fast. To run those CI assertions locally you need the perf-fixtures archive, which is encrypted. The unpack script prompts once on first run. When prompted, enter the recovery passphrase printed below.

recovery phrase for fawif-tajeg: norael-aldmir-casir-brivan-ulaion

- [ ] **Step 7: Breaker override escrow.** After sealing the signing keys for the Tallgrove upstream API circuit breaker, confirm the support team can force the breaker open during a full outage. The override bundle lives in the sealed escrow drawer and is useless without its unlock phrase. Two ceremony witnesses must initial this step before proceeding. The escrow bundle is decrypted with the recovery passphrase that follows.

vault phrase of kahip-kahop = holath-quenmir

Action item: The Relayn deploy-status bot silently dropped updates when the pipeline API paginated results, so responders believed a rollback had completed when it had not. We will add pagination handling, a staleness banner, and an integration test. Until merged, verify deploy state directly in the pipeline console, documented at the page below.

runbook for kahop-kajop: https://rundeck.ordinio.test/display/secrets/pipeline/issue/pages/repo/browse/e5732776e07d1285107e5aeb